MEQUON, Wis. (CBS 58) -- An elderly woman was taken to the hospital with second degree burns after a condo-complex fire on Sunday, March 2.
It happened on Ivy Court off of Greenbrier in Mequon. The Southern Ozaukee Fire Department Chief David Bialk told CBS 58 that they got the call around 3:30 p.m.
Several units responded.
The elderly woman was the only one injured, and the fire was contained into her apartment.
However, we're told there is a lot of smoke and water damage to other units.
The cause of the fire is under investigation.
